Three Scouts Pass Eagle Boards of Review

Scouts Donald Bey, Chris Aultman, and Thomas Neff have all passed their Eagle Boards of Review and are now the latest of the thirty Eagle Scouts of Troop 422. Donald passed his Board of Review on August 2, 2007, while Chris and Thomas met with their Boards on October 10, 2007.

For his Eagle project, Donald led the construction of an outdoor meeting area at Stewarts Creek Church of Christ, where the troop meets. Chris directed a project to paint the hallways of Thurman Francis Middle School over the Christmas break, and Thomas led the construction of an observation platform overlooking the dam at Gregory Mills Park in Smyrna.

The dates for the Eagle Courts of Honor for these scouts have not yet been announced.
